Photo sequence for this cordyceps
Begin with one uncropped overview, then add the full batch, insect bodies, grass tips, break points, count, weight and packaging label; keep a wider locating view beside every close-up so the requested detail stays tied to Cordyceps.
Use close-ups of dryness, broken pieces, mould, insect damage and odour for Cordyceps; nothing should be polished, retouched or rearranged to improve the photographs.
Keeping condition and packaging unchanged
Between photography and handover, keep the item dry, cool and sealed in its current packaging; do not wash, soak, trim or mix material from different packages; retain the same arrangement for the next review.
To keep every supplied component traceable to Cordyceps, retain each batch, package, weight label, receipt and provenance document together; separate views can then record damage or omissions.
